For beginning students I typicaly start with a introduction book like Hal Leonard's Guitar Method Book 1 for younger students, and Solo Guitar Playing book 1 by Fredrick Noad for older and experienced students. Once fundamental techniques are acquired, I introduce repertoire suited for each student and they can participate in a performance. For older students I will work on the music they are interested in and integrate challenging material accordingly to keep lessons engaging and fun. Read More
